What is a Domain?
Your website’s domain is your unique identity. Whether you already have a domain from your current website or you’re starting from scratch, your domain is the foundation of your website. Usually, it’s important to keep your domain consistent overtime to maintain brand recognition and awareness among your audience. The domain name you register is yours as long as you keep renewing it.
Domain Ownership
When looking for a digital marketer to create your website, you have many different choices. A partnership with a website designer or developer will usually end as soon as your website is complete. Another option is to work with a digital marketing agency. Agencies often can create your website and help you maintain it. Before you hire any digital marketer, it’s important to find out who will have control over and ownership of your domain.
Because your domain is so closely associated with your business, many business owners will assume that they own their website’s domain. Unfortunately, not all marketers operate under that assumption. Domain ownership is important for a few key reasons:
- Your domain is your website’s main identifier which is important for brand recognition and accessibility.
- Your domain is also tied to the content on your site and your site history which determines your organic search rankings.
In other words, you may be locked into a partnership with a digital marketer if you want to keep your domain. Because of this, it’s usually best to keep control of your domain. If your digital marketer does buy your domain for you, make sure you’re able to take the domain with you if you decide you want to work with someone else.
